Why does Free Tier instance not appear on the used Free Tier tab?

0

Hello, I've registered to AWS today and started using the Free Tier features in EC2. I created an instance that uses all the free tier features and launched it. And yet when I go to my billing and cost management tab, it says that there are 0 free tier services used. Why is that and does that mean I'm going to be charged?

It will take some time for it to be reflected in "billing and cost management".
It may take 24 hours, so I think it will be reflected tomorrow.
https://docs.aws.amazon.com/awsaccountbilling/latest/aboutv2/view-billing-dashboard.html

The data on this page comes from AWS Cost Explorer. If you haven’t used Cost Explorer before, it’s automatically enabled for you once you visit this page. It can take up to 24 hours for your data to appear on this page. When available, your data will be refreshed at least once every 24 hours. The Cost Explorer data on the home page is tailored for analytical purposes. This means the data can differ from your invoices and the Bills page due to differences in how data is grouped into AWS services; how discounts, credits, refunds, and taxes are displayed; differences in timing for the current month's estimated charges; and rounding.

Hello

it can take a little while for usage to be reflected accurately in your billing dashboard. The usage may not immediately appear in the " Free Tier" section, but as long as you've launched an instance that qualifies for the Free Tier, you should not be charged for it.
